¿Cuánto cuesta crear una aplicación para Android e iOS que pueda volar un dron?
Publicado: 2023-04-26Los drones se han vuelto cada vez más populares en los últimos años gracias a su versatilidad y capacidad para ser utilizados en diversas industrias. Se emplean para una variedad de tareas, que incluyen fotografía aérea, topografía, misiones de búsqueda y rescate e incluso entrega de paquetes, con la capacidad de acceder rápidamente a la información y completar una variedad de tareas mientras se desplaza; Las aplicaciones móviles también se han convertido en una herramienta indispensable en nuestra vida cotidiana. Como resultado, la industria ha visto una tendencia considerable en la creación de aplicaciones para teléfonos inteligentes que pueden pilotar y controlar drones.
Tabla de contenido
Importancia de las aplicaciones de drones en varias industrias

Las aplicaciones de drones han revolucionado muchas industrias, brindando beneficios significativos en eficiencia, rentabilidad y seguridad. Por ejemplo, en la agricultura, los drones con cámaras y sensores pueden recopilar información sobre el crecimiento de los cultivos, la calidad del suelo y los requisitos de riego, brindando a los agricultores conocimientos cruciales para mejorar sus operaciones. Los drones pueden inspeccionar los sitios de trabajo, rastrear el progreso e inspeccionar edificios en la industria de la construcción, lo que reduce los costos de mano de obra y aumenta la seguridad.
Los drones brindan a las industrias del cine y la fotografía un nuevo punto de vista que antes era inalcanzable, lo que permite impresionantes vistas y puntos de vista aéreos. Los drones también se utilizan en los esfuerzos de búsqueda y rescate, lo que permite a los rescatistas cubrir áreas enormes de manera rápida y efectiva. Por último, pero no menos importante, el uso de drones para la entrega de paquetes puede reducir los gastos y los tiempos de entrega al tiempo que mejora la eficiencia.
Comprender los componentes de una aplicación de drones
Hay varios componentes principales que controlan juntos para controlar y administrar las funciones del dron. Estos componentes son: -
1. Interfaz de usuario
Es la parte interactiva y visual de la aplicación que permite al usuario comunicarse con el dron. Incluye menús, botones y otros elementos gráficos que permiten al usuario controlar el movimiento del dron, ver la transmisión de video en vivo desde la cámara del dron y ajustar la configuración de la cámara.
2. Conectividad
Estos componentes permiten que la aplicación se comunique con los drones a través de protocolos inalámbricos como Wi-Fi, datos móviles o Bluetooth. También facilita la comunicación con los componentes de hardware del dron, como sus sensores y GPS.
3. Navegación
Este es responsable de controlar el dron y también asegura que el dron se mueva en la ruta o trayectoria correcta. Esto incluye características tales como despegues y aterrizajes automáticos, navegación por waypoints y modo sígueme.
4. Control de cámara
Los ajustes, como la exposición, el enfoque y la resolución de la cámara, se pueden ajustar con la ayuda del componente de control de la cámara. También permite al usuario capturar fotos y videos desde la cámara del dron y verlos en tiempo real.
5. Datos y análisis de vuelos
La altitud, la velocidad y el nivel de la batería del dron se encuentran entre los datos del sensor que recopila y examina el componente de análisis y datos de vuelo. El rendimiento del dron se mejora con la ayuda de estos datos, que también le dan al usuario acceso al historial de vuelo del dron.
Diferentes funciones de una aplicación de drones
Un dron puede funcionar de varias formas según las industrias; Aquí hay algunas funciones del dron que puedes ver.
1. Recopilación de datos
La aplicación puede recopilar los datos de los sensores del dron, incluida la temperatura, el GPS, la altitud y otros datos ambientales. Estos datos pueden ser importantes para industrias como la agricultura que pueden usarse para monitorear la salud de los cultivos, los niveles de humedad del suelo y otras variables que afectan el crecimiento de los cultivos.
2. Análisis y Mapeo
Las aplicaciones de drones pueden usar los datos recopilados de los sensores del dron para crear mapas y analizar datos. Esto podría ser útil en campos como la construcción y la topografía porque el programa puede hacer mapas en 3D de una ubicación o propiedad y examinar información como la altura y el terreno.
3. Funciones de seguridad
La aplicación también proporciona funciones de seguridad, como geofencing, que evita que el dron vuele fuera de un área predefinida. La aplicación también puede proporcionar alertas sobre niveles bajos de batería o mal tiempo, lo que garantiza operaciones de vuelo seguras.
4. Transmisión de video en vivo
El usuario puede monitorear los alrededores del dron en tiempo real usando una aplicación de dron que ofrece una transmisión de video en vivo desde la cámara del dron. En campos como búsqueda y rescate, donde la aplicación puede mostrar una vista panorámica de la región que se está buscando, esto puede ser especialmente útil.
5. Modos de vuelo automatizados
Las aplicaciones de drones pueden ofrecer muchos modos de vuelo automáticos, como el modo de órbita, donde el dron rodeará un lugar en particular, o el modo de cámara de cable, donde el dron seguirá una ruta planificada previamente. Estos modos de vuelo automatizados pueden ser útiles para tomar fotografías cinematográficas y hacer grabaciones de alto calibre.
6. Almacenamiento y uso compartido de datos
Los datos recopilados por los sensores y la cámara del dron pueden almacenarse y administrarse mediante una aplicación de dron. Además, la aplicación puede ofrecer opciones para difundir esta información a otros miembros del equipo o partes interesadas, lo que puede ser muy útil en sectores como la construcción y la topografía.
7. Interfaz de usuario personalizable
La interfaz de usuario de una aplicación de drones se puede modificar para adaptarse a los requisitos particulares del usuario o la industria. Esto puede incluir la capacidad de interactuar con otros sistemas de software o API, así como botones, menús y otros elementos gráficos únicos.
8. Integración con otras tecnologías
La inteligencia artificial (IA) también se puede integrar en aplicaciones de drones para mejorar la experiencia del usuario. En combinación con la realidad virtual (VR) y la realidad aumentada (AR), la IA puede ofrecer una experiencia más inmersiva y participativa. Por ejemplo, en campos como la arquitectura y los bienes raíces, una aplicación puede ofrecer un modelo 3D de un lugar que se puede explorar mediante tecnología VR o AR, y la IA se puede usar para brindar recomendaciones personalizadas basadas en las preferencias del usuario. Esto puede ser especialmente útil para los usuarios que desean explorar diferentes opciones antes de tomar una decisión.
Factores que afectan el costo de crear una aplicación de drones para Android e iOS
El costo de crear una aplicación de drones para Android e iOS puede variar según varios factores, que incluyen:
1. Características y funcionalidad
El costo de la aplicación de drones dependerá de cuán complicadas sean las características y funcionalidades. El costo del desarrollo aumentará con capacidades más sofisticadas como la transmisión de video en tiempo real, los modos de vuelo automáticos y el intercambio de datos.
2. Diseño y Experiencia de Usuario
Una aplicación de dron intuitiva y bien diseñada puede impulsar la adopción del usuario y mejorar toda la experiencia del usuario. Sin embargo, el precio del desarrollo puede aumentar si se diseña una interfaz de usuario y una experiencia de alta calidad.
3. Compatibilidad de plataformas
El precio de desarrollar software para drones puede aumentar si se hace tanto para iOS como para Android. Esto es así porque se necesitan varias herramientas y metodologías de desarrollo para cada plataforma.
4. Integración de hardware
El costo de desarrollo puede aumentar si el software del dron se integra con elementos de hardware como el controlador de vuelo y la cámara del dron. Esto se debe al hecho de que la integración de componentes de hardware y software requiere conocimientos y experiencia especializados.
5. Cumplimiento normativo
Las aplicaciones de drones deben cumplir con una serie de reglas, incluidas las que rigen el espacio aéreo y la protección de datos. El costo de desarrollo puede aumentar cuando se garantiza el cumplimiento normativo.
6. Ubicación del equipo de desarrollo
El costo del desarrollo puede variar según la ubicación del equipo de desarrollo. Los equipos de desarrollo cobrarán más por sus servicios si se encuentran en países con mayores gastos de mano de obra.
7. Pruebas y Mantenimiento
Para asegurarse de que la aplicación de drones funcione correctamente y esté actualizada con las últimas leyes y tecnología, las pruebas y el mantenimiento son cruciales. El costo total de desarrollo debe tener en cuenta estos gastos continuos.
8. Seguridad y privacidad de los datos
Las aplicaciones de drones pueden recopilar y retener información privada, incluidas imágenes, videos e información de ubicación. Es crucial garantizar la confidencialidad y privacidad de estos datos, lo que puede requerir medidas de seguridad adicionales y aumentar el costo de desarrollo.
Desglose de costos de la creación de una aplicación de drones para Android e iOS
El costo de crear una aplicación de drones para Android e iOS puede variar según los factores que discutimos anteriormente. Aquí hay un desglose del costo estimado para cada etapa del proceso de desarrollo.
Planificación y Análisis | Esta etapa implica definir los requisitos, determinar el alcance del proyecto y crear un plan de proyecto. El costo de esta etapa puede oscilar entre $1,500 y $5,000 . |
Interfaz de usuario y experiencia | La interfaz de usuario de la aplicación de drones y el diseño de la experiencia son esenciales para su éxito. Dependiendo de cuán complicado sea el diseño, este paso puede costar entre $2,000 y $10,000 . |
Desarrollo | Las características y la funcionalidad de la aplicación se crean durante la etapa de desarrollo, que puede tardar varios meses en completarse. Dependiendo de la complejidad del software y la tarifa por hora del equipo de desarrollo, el costo de esta etapa puede oscilar entre $20,000 y $100,000 o más. |
Pruebas | Esta etapa consiste en probar la aplicación para asegurarse de que funciona correctamente y cumple con los requisitos. El costo de esta etapa puede oscilar entre $3,000 y $10,000 . |
Mantenimiento continuo y actualizaciones | Una vez que se lanza la aplicación, se requiere un mantenimiento y actualizaciones continuos para que cumpla con los avances tecnológicos y los requisitos legales más recientes. Esta etapa puede costar entre $5,000 y $20,000 al año. |
El costo de crear una aplicación de drones para iOS o Android puede oscilar entre $ 32,000 y $ 145,000 o más, según la complejidad de la aplicación, la empresa que maneja su proyecto y los costos continuos de mantenimiento y soporte. Es necesario considerar todos los factores que pueden afectar el costo y el trabajo del desarrollo. Esto ayuda a garantizar la entrega del proyecto dentro de su presupuesto.


Ejemplos de aplicaciones de drones para Android e iOS
Estos son algunos ejemplos de aplicaciones de drones para Android e iOS, junto con sus costos.
1. DJI GO 4

DJI GO 4 es una aplicación móvil para controlar drones y productos DJI en dispositivos iOS y Android. Permite el control de la cámara en tiempo real, configuraciones personalizables y acceso a datos de telemetría como la altitud, la velocidad y la duración de la batería. Con modos de vuelo inteligentes como ActiveTrack y TapFly, la aplicación garantiza vuelos suaves y sin esfuerzo. DJI GO 4 es imprescindible para cualquier propietario de drones DJI.
2. Captura Pix4D

Pix4Dcapture es una aplicación de planificación de vuelos de drones para mapeo y topografía. La aplicación funciona con drones DJI y ofrece opciones de planificación de vuelo personalizables con funciones de seguridad. Una vez que se capturan las imágenes, se cargan para su procesamiento en el software Pix4D para crear mapas y modelos. La aplicación es una herramienta valiosa para los profesionales de diversas industrias, ya que hace que la cartografía aérea y la topografía sean más eficientes.
3. Implementación de drones

DroneDeploy es una plataforma de análisis y mapeo de drones basada en la nube que simplifica el proceso de captura y análisis de datos aéreos. Su interfaz fácil de usar permite a los usuarios planificar, volar y capturar imágenes de alta calidad, que luego se procesan para generar mapas de alta resolución, modelos 3D y otras visualizaciones. Además, la aplicación incluye funciones que mejoran el flujo de trabajo y la colaboración, lo que la convierte en una herramienta esencial para empresas y personas de diversas industrias.
4. Mapa aéreo

AirMap es una aplicación diseñada para que los operadores de drones accedan a servicios de mapeo e inteligencia del espacio aéreo en tiempo real. La aplicación brinda a los usuarios información sobre las regulaciones del espacio aéreo, avisos cercanos y notificaciones automáticas de vuelos. Con herramientas cartográficas intuitivas, que incluyen vistas del espacio aéreo en 3D, imágenes satelitales y mapas interactivos, los operadores de drones pueden planificar sus vuelos con precisión. Las alertas de tráfico en tiempo real de la aplicación también permiten a los operadores de drones evitar posibles colisiones, lo que garantiza vuelos seguros y legales.
5. lichi

Litchi es una aplicación móvil diseñada para pilotos de drones que ofrece herramientas avanzadas para capturar imágenes aéreas de alta calidad, crear mapas en 3D y automatizar vuelos. Su editor de waypoints permite un mapeo preciso, mientras que los modos panorama, enfoque y órbita agregan un toque cinematográfico. Es una herramienta poderosa y fácil de usar tanto para entusiastas novatos como para profesionales experimentados.
Consejos para reducir el costo de crear una aplicación para drones
En esta sección, discutiremos algunos consejos que puede usar para reducir el costo de desarrollar la aplicación de drones sin comprometer la calidad. Además, los consejos para encontrar un equipo de desarrollo confiable y asequible para cada plataforma.
1. Planifique y priorice sus características
Antes de comenzar el desarrollo, debe asegurarse de la función que desea incluir en la aplicación. Haz una lista de los más y menos importantes y ordénalos. Esto ayudará a reducir el costo de este proceso.
2. Utilice bibliotecas de código abierto
Estos se pueden utilizar para reducir los costos y el tiempo de desarrollo. Estos se pueden usar para tareas como el diseño de la interfaz de usuario, la conectividad y el almacenamiento de datos.
3. Considere el desarrollo multiplataforma
Las herramientas de desarrollo multiplataforma como React Native y Flutter le permiten desarrollar simultáneamente su aplicación para Android e iOS. Este enfoque puede ahorrarle tiempo y dinero, ya que no necesitará desarrollar aplicaciones separadas para cada plataforma.
4. Encuentre un equipo de desarrollo confiable y asequible
Es fundamental elegir un equipo de desarrollo que tenga experiencia, sea competente y tenga un precio competitivo. Investigue y revise los comentarios de los consumidores antes de externalizar el trabajo de desarrollo a países con menores gastos de desarrollo.
5. Mantenga la comunicación clara
La buena comunicación es clave para mantener bajos los costos de desarrollo. Asegúrese de que la comunicación entre usted y el equipo de desarrollo sea clara y concisa. Esto ayudará a evitar malentendidos que pueden conducir a costos de desarrollo adicionales.
6. Prueba a fondo
Para asegurarse de que su aplicación de dron funcione según lo previsto, la prueba es esencial. Las pruebas exhaustivas pueden ayudarlo a encontrar problemas desde el principio y solucionarlos, lo que en última instancia puede ahorrarle dinero. Gaste dinero en pruebas exhaustivas ahora para ahorrar dinero en futuras reparaciones.
Diferencias de costos entre la creación de una aplicación de drones para Android e iOS
Desarrollar una aplicación de drones para iOS suele costar más que crear una para Android. Esto se debe a que el entorno de iOS es estricto y requiere el uso de herramientas específicas y requisitos rigurosos para los desarrolladores. Por el contrario, la apertura de la plataforma Android permite a los desarrolladores emplear una mayor variedad de herramientas y puede reducir el costo de desarrollo. La complejidad de la aplicación y las tarifas por hora cobradas por el equipo de desarrollo pueden afectar significativamente el precio de desarrollar una aplicación para cada plataforma.
Para características y funcionalidades específicas, ambas plataformas ofrecen capacidades similares, como seguimiento por GPS, control de cámara y evitación de obstáculos. Sin embargo, la implementación exacta de estas funciones puede diferir ligeramente entre las plataformas debido a sus diferentes ecosistemas y herramientas de desarrollo. Por ejemplo, las aplicaciones de Android pueden acceder a más funciones de hardware de bajo nivel que las aplicaciones de iOS, lo que permite funciones más avanzadas y hace que el desarrollo sea más complejo.

¿Por qué elegir Emizentech para el desarrollo rentable de aplicaciones de drones?
Emizentech es una empresa de TI de primer nivel que ofrece servicios rentables de desarrollo de aplicaciones de drones. Aquí hay algunas razones por las que debería elegirnos para el desarrollo rentable de aplicaciones de drones.
equipo experimentado | Contamos con un equipo de desarrolladores experimentados que entienden profundamente la tecnología de drones y sus aplicaciones. Son competentes en lenguajes de programación y han entregado con éxito numerosos proyectos de desarrollo de aplicaciones de drones. |
Soluciones personalizadas | Entendemos que cada negocio tiene requisitos únicos. Por lo tanto, brindan soluciones de desarrollo de aplicaciones de drones personalizadas que se adaptan a las necesidades específicas de sus clientes. Nuestro equipo trabaja en estrecha colaboración con los clientes para garantizar que el producto final cumpla con sus expectativas. |
Seguro de calidad | Contamos con un equipo dedicado de profesionales que se aseguran de que todas las aplicaciones de drones que desarrollan estén libres de errores y funcionen a la perfección. |
Precio competitivo | Brindamos servicios de desarrollo de aplicaciones rentables sin comprometer la calidad. Y ofrezca modelos de precios flexibles que se adapten al presupuesto de pequeñas y grandes empresas por igual. |
Conclusión
El costo de crear una aplicación de Android e iOS para volar un dron puede depender de varios factores, como la empresa de desarrollo que elija, el tamaño de su proyecto y las funciones que desea incluir en la aplicación. Siempre puede trabajar para reducir el costo del desarrollo siguiendo algunos pasos clave. Espero que este blog haya ayudado a comprender el concepto de costo relacionado con el desarrollo de la aplicación del dron. Pero si todavía está confundido y no sabe con quién hablar, puede contactarnos en cualquier momento y puede obtener la asistencia adecuada con sus dudas.
Blogs relacionados
¡10 alucinantes ideas de aplicaciones de drones para revolucionar la forma en que vuelas!
Desarrollo de aplicaciones de entrega de drones bajo demanda: una guía completa
Preguntas frecuentes Preguntas frecuentes
Es posible usar la misma base de código usando las herramientas de desarrollo multiplataforma como Flutter o React Native. Sin embargo, la implementación final y las funciones de la aplicación pueden diferir ligeramente en cada plataforma debido a las diferencias en sus ecosistemas y herramientas de desarrollo.
Usando herramientas de desarrollo multiplataforma como React Native o Flutter, es posible crear software para drones que funcione en iOS y Android simultáneamente. Se puede aumentar la eficiencia y se pueden reducir los gastos de desarrollo mediante el uso de una única base de código para ambas plataformas.
El control remoto de drones, la transmisión de video en tiempo real, el seguimiento por GPS y los modos de vuelo autónomos son algunas características a tener en cuenta al desarrollar una aplicación de drones. Las capacidades de geoperimetraje y evasión de obstáculos también pueden mejorar la seguridad de la aplicación.
Vender su aplicación de dron en tiendas de aplicaciones como Google Play y Apple App Store es una forma legítima de ganar dinero. Los desarrolladores tienen la opción de cobrar una tarifa o regalar su software a cambio de publicidad o compras dentro de la aplicación. Al elegir el precio de la aplicación, es fundamental tener en cuenta los impuestos y la comisión de la tienda de aplicaciones.